Chalet Loden
Spectacular views and old-English charm: this classic chalet in Méribel sleeps 12 guests in 6 bedrooms.
With uninterrupted views of the pine forests and ski slopes of Méribel, Chalet Loden is tucked away up a winding pathway in a tranquil and sunny spot on the eastern side of the mountain.
To access the Three Valleys ski area and lifts, take the blue Doron run, a short walk from the chalet entrance. You'll arrive in the Chaudanne, Méribel’s main lift hub from which you can take the lifts in the direction of the Belleville Valley for Saint Martin, Les Menuires or Val Thorens, or over to Saulire and the whole Courchevel ski area.

Accommodation:
Inside Chalet Loden you will find plentiful space for relaxing in the L-shaped sitting room which surrounds an impressive fireplace. It's a lovely setting for a wintry evening, and the dining room has plenty of elbow room and you can tuck into the home-cooked meal which is included as part of our catered service, whilst enjoying the twinkling lights of the resort and the floodlit Roc de Fer piste.
When the sun is shining, Chalet Loden is in a prime sunny spot, and with its huge balcony doors and unimpeded views, you can spend hours gazing at the snow-capped mountains.
The Loden also has large rooms and comfy beds with quality bedding, so you’ll be well-rested and ready for action the next day, after your chalet breakfast.

- A wholesome breakfast including teas, coffee, fruit juice, cereals, yoghurts, French bread, butter and jam is available to help yourself to every day.
- A hot option is served by your host on four mornings.
- Afternoon tea is available to help yourselves to every day.
- Evening meals are provided on six evenings: five with dinner-party style dinners and one evening when you will be provided with all you need for a traditional 'raclette'.
- Red, white and rose wine is available during mealtimes.
- Most dietary requirements can be catered for, please advise at time of booking.
- Early meals are served for children up to age 12.
- An honesty bar is available in the chalet for beers, mixers and snacks.
- A fresh bowl of fruit is always available
